Hi everyone.

Ive read the posts about General Grabbers etc. I am looking for a more agressive tyre. I was hoping that i could fit the maxxis bighorn 275 65 18. The only problem is that they are only an 8 ply. I had the Buckshot on my D2 and they were a great tyre. I wanted to come back a bit with the focus being on a bit more rock and sand. That being said its hard to find tyres that fit those 18 inch rims. I'm also not that keen on Coopers, slashed three side walls one weekend in Victoria. Maxxis mudders a month later, same line, same pressure, no problems.

Anybody put the MAxxis on a D3 with 18's and does anybody have any other suggestions as to what tyres are available would be welcome.
